Populate Drop-Down from Database Using VBA
Hello, I have a spreadsheet with 4 drop-down boxes. On open, I would like to populate these 4 drop-down boxes with results returned from a database query (SQL Server 2000). Is this possible? I've used VBA and ADO 'behind' the sheet to open a database connection, execute a query, and return the results, but I can't figure out now how to stick the result set into the drop-down box. Does anyone know how to do this? Thanks. |
